A Spanish nurse being treated for ebola has said she did not tell doctors she had been in contact with the virus and only found out she had the disease after reading the news online.
The 40-year-old told Spanish TV station Cuatro she did not consider she might have ebola until the last moment.
She said: "I found out on my mobile phone. I felt something was up because to begin with the doctors and nurses in Alcorcon were coming in and out every hour and then they start to come in less often.
"Then I was listening to them behind the door and I suspected something, then the last time they came in white suits.
"I asked my doctor for my result and they weren't very clear with me and then I really suspected it.
"I got my mobile and I read on (Spanish news website) El Pais that they'd said I had two positive tests for ebola. But no one had told me."
